X, the former Twitter, lets users hide once-vaunted blue check


Blue ticks, long free at Twitter, were intended to signal the identity of certain users – such as journalists, celebrities and politicians – had been verified in an effort to build trust in the platform. — AFP Relaxnews

SAN FRANCISCO: Users on the social media platform X, formerly known as Twitter, will now be allowed to hide their once-prized blue check marks, the company says.

A coveted status symbol at Twitter before Elon Musk bought the company, the blue checks have been mocked by some as a sign that the user is willing to pay for special treatment.
